The Issuemakers work for Transdev Netherlands

We have been working for Transdev Netherlands since February. We support the Corporate Communications department of the leading mobility company, which is active in the Dutch market with well-known brand names such as Connexxion and Hermes. We also support Transdev in the development and implementation of communication strategies for proactive issue management and thought leadership.

Transdev provides innovative mobility solutions for passenger transport and is a leader in Dutch public transport in the field of sustainable (electric) vehicles and initiatives. This fits in seamlessly with De Issuemakers' objective to work for organizations that have or want to have a positive social impact.

“The Netherlands will face important mobility challenges in the coming years. Transdev plays an important role in solving these challenges because of its international experience, innovative strength and strong presence in the Dutch market. To make this possible, we want to explicitly participate in the public debate about mobility and related social issues. De Issuemakers has proven experience and expertise in the field of social communication and is therefore an attractive collaboration partner for us,” says Gjalt Rameijer, Corporate Communications Manager of Transdev.

Jordi Bouman of De Issuemakers: “The social contribution of Transdev in the Netherlands cannot be underestimated. Connexxion, for example, is the largest regional carrier in the Netherlands. But Transdev's value is greater than the sum of the brands it owns in the Netherlands. The company offers innovative mobility solutions in 20 countries and plays a leading role internationally in the field of sustainable transport. The Netherlands has also been designated by the company as a priority market. We are proud to collaborate with Transdev to support their social efforts on important issues such as: zero emissions, self-driving vehicles and Mobility as a service to put it even more firmly on the map.”
